Zero Carb Crustless Pizza Bowl

If you love pizza but want to avoid carbs entirely, the crustless pizza bowl is your best friend. It keeps everything you love—melty cheese, rich sauce, savory meats—without the dough. This dish is simple, fast, customizable, and surprisingly satisfying. Think of it as a baked pizza in a bowl, loaded with flavor and zero guilt.

Cook time10–15 minutes
Servings2 servings

Equipment

  • oven
  • pan
  • oven-safe bowl or dish

Ingredients

  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• ½ c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ional for richness)
  • 150–200g ground beef OR Italian sausage OR diced chicken or pepperoni slices
  • 2–4 tbsp low-carb or zero-carb pizza sauce (optional if strict zero carb)
  • Mushrooms (low carb, optional)
  • Black olives
  • Green peppers
  • Pepperoni slices
  • Cooked bacon bits
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ning
  • ½ tsp garlic powder
  • Salt & p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F).
  2. In a pan, cook ground beef or sausage until browned. Drain excess fat if needed. Season with sal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
  3. In an oven-safe bowl or dish, add cooked meat as the base. Spoon a thin layer of sauce (optional). Add toppings (pepperoni, olives, etc.). Cover generously with shredded cheese.
  4. Bake for 10–15 minutes until cheese is melted and bubbly. Broil for 1–2 minutes for a golden top (optional).
  5. Let it cool slightly, then dig in with a spoon—no crust needed.

Notes

To keep it truly zero carb, use a no-sugar tomato sauce or replace it with a creamy cheese base. Variations include a strict zero-carb version (skip tomato sauce, use melted cheese + meat juices), a creamy version (add cream cheese or heavy cream), a spicy version (add chili flakes or spicy sausage), or an air fryer method (cook at 180°C for 7–10 minutes).

Nutrition

Calories: 400–550 kcal · Protein: 25–35g · Fat: 30–40g · Carbohydrates: 1–3g · Fiber: 0–1g · Net Carbs: ~1–2g
